Invite a group of girls (and the moms or trusted adults they're close with) you'd love to build community with. Intentional. Warm. Small enough to feel personal.
Use the digital invitation to set expectations clearly. Parents will appreciate the heads-up - and the chance to be part of it.
Follow the host guide. Watch the videos together. Work through the workbook. End with the backpack pin moment and hand out a kit for each girl to take home with her, so the confidence keeps going long after the party ends.
